North of the Great Himalayan range, amongst a tangled
knot of jagged mountains, lies a rugged and fascinating
land, the once independent kingdom of Zanskar. Sandwiched
between the Indus Valley and the main crest of the Indian
Himalaya, this remote and inaccessible setting, well
guarded by snowy mountain passes, has kept alive an
archaic form of Tibetan Buddhism which flourishes in
chain of far-flung monasteries, most of which occupy
spectacular fortified locations, high on rocky ridges
in isolated valleys. Lovely high meadow camp sites and
dry desert land, high passes and snow-capped peaks stunning
scenery, Buddhist monasteries and picturesque villages
with their irrigated fields of barley and potatoes,
and fascinating encounters with the Zanskari people
turn a trek in this area into an unforgettable experience.
